Output 1576998026789adadad8994fb8072189506a45397d67931c4aefb5f66e834b96:2

value
23524
script pubkey
OP_0 OP_PUSHBYTES_20 bf4c75a6dd5e5d136d5c9d079f0a78571b9cb19f
address
bc1qhax8tfkatew3xm2un5re7znc2udeevvlznyqzv
transaction
1576998026789adadad8994fb8072189506a45397d67931c4aefb5f66e834b96